Israel plans for ‘long war’ and aims to kill top three Hamas leaders, FT reports.
Israel is planning a campaign against Hamas that will stretch for a year or more, with the most intensive phase of the ground offensive continuing into early 2024.
The multi-phase strategy envisages Israeli forces, who are garrisoned inside north Gaza, making an imminent push deep into the south of the besieged Palestinian enclave.
The goals include killing the three top Hamas leaders — Yahya Sinwar, Mohammed Deif and Marwan Issa — while securing “a decisive” military victory against the group’s 24 battalions and underground tunnel network and destroying its “governing capability in Gaza”.
“This will be a very long war . . . We’re currently not near halfway to achieving our objectives,” said one person familiar with the Israeli war plans.
Israel’s overall strategy for Gaza is flexible, with timing dictated by multiple “clocks”, including operational progress on the ground, international pressure and opportunities to free Israeli hostages, the people said.
The renewed high-intensity ground operation will probably require a few more months, taking it into the new year, the people familiar with the preparations estimated.
“This isn’t going to be weeks,” said one person familiar with US-Israel discussions over the war.
After that, there will be a “transition and stabilisation” phase of lower military intensity that could continue into late 2024, with the location of Israeli ground forces during this phase still unclear.
Unlike previous Israeli military operations and wars, one Israeli official suggested there would not be a firm end point.
“The referee won’t blow the whistle and it’s over,” they said.
